I'm not saying it did not happen to you,

Just that you are wrong to say the TPMS sends a speed signal to the ABS system.

That's 100% BS,
sounds like the similar crap a dealership tried to sell me when I swapped my old chrome clad 20's to the new 14' Sport Wheels.
I knew the new 14's had a different sensor than my 10' came with, but their price and the reprogramming sounded sketchy.

They tried to tell me I had to pay $142 ea for new TPMS sensors,
then Pay them an extra $40 to have them activated and programmed to my truck.

Thats over $600!!!


I got my OEM sensors on ebay for $69 set of 4
installed at a local tire shop with new tires.

The computer picked up the new signals on their own within a 10 minute drive.

I'm sure glad I followed fellow ram owners advice from the forums.

You are way off base. Tire pressure sensors are for tire pressure. Nothing else. Wheel size does not matter at all. The over all tire diameter is what matters for abs and traction control. Don't know what your dealer told you but I have worked at a ram dealer for 5 years.
